About Satyam Kumar Agrawal

Satyam Kumar Agrawal is a scholar working on Toxicology, Organic Chemistry and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ology, having authored 43 papers that have together received 736 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Synthesis and biological activity (9 papers), Synthesis and Biological Evaluation (7 papers) and Bioactive Compounds and Antitumor Agents (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Toxicology (82 citations), Pharmaceutical Science (88 citations) and Organic Chemistry (351 citations). Satyam Kumar Agrawal has collaborated with scholars based in India, Singapore and United States. Frequent co-authors include Ajit Kumar Saxena, Sham M. Sondhi, Reshma Rani, Partha Roy, Pankaj Gupta, Harshad Harde, Rahul Sonawane, Sanyog Jain, Arpita Saxena and Halmuthur M. Sampath Kumar.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Materials Science, Gene and Food and Chemical Toxicology.
